Dhadhra
Dhadhra is a village located in Harrai tehsil of Chhindwara district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Harrai (tehsildar office) and 90km away from district headquarter Chhindwara. As per 2009 stats, Ghoghari is the gram panchayat of Dhadhra village.

About Dhadhra
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dhadhra is 494143. The village spans a total geographical area of 604.17 hectares. Harrai is nearest town to Dhadhra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Dhadhra
According to the 2011 Census, Dhadhra has a total population of about 220, with approximately 100 males and 120 females. The sex ratio is around 1200 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 43 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There is 1 member of the Scheduled Castes (SC) community, an important social group here.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 217. The overall literacy rate is approximately 31.82%, with male literacy at about 31.00% and female literacy near 32.50%. There are around 46 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 220 | 100 | 120 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 43 | 18 | 25 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1 | 1 |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 217 | 98 | 119 |
Literate Population | 70 | 31 | 39 |
Illiterate Population | 150 | 69 | 81 |
Connectivity of Dhadhra
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dhadhra. As per the 2011 stats, Dhadhra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available |
